Okay, this may sound funny and I've tried searching the web to no avail. I've just recently upgraded my Firefox and so far it's working...until when I double-clicked on the web page (the fast way to block a whole paragraph to be copied). The Firefox then suddenly crashed. First I thought there might be a web page which caused the problem, but when I experimented double-clicking on the Firefox Homepage, the problem persisted. This hasn't happened before and I have no idea what error does the double-click induces. The other processes---downloading, uploading, etc.---works fine. Maybe you guys will find it minor, but still it annoys me every time I forget and double-click.

You have or had an extension installed (MegaUpload toolbar) that has changed the user agent from Firefox/3.6.7 to Firefox/3.5.3.

You can see the Firefox version at the top and the user agent at bottom of the "Help > About" window (Mac: Firefox > About Mozilla Firefox).

You can check the general.useragent prefs on the about:config page. You can open the about:config page via the location bar, just like you open a website. Filter: general.useragent If general.useragent prefs are bold (user set) then you can right-click that pref and choose Reset.
